Output 5477977d8c3f42e01144e3e70b09a02fda36b5ec7aa8ed38fbfbc84c8300c7c3:0

value
663000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73efba9f9a3e6d03f582c3a260dbe50bb7ecb626 OP_EQUAL
address
3CG2pGSYzmNBk3yycBKgswLhiWyQXYDaJs
transaction
5477977d8c3f42e01144e3e70b09a02fda36b5ec7aa8ed38fbfbc84c8300c7c3
confirmations
322903
spent
true